Selfresonance tuning piezoelectric energy harvester with broadband operation frequency

The present invention relates to a self-resonance-controlled piezoelectric energy harvester having a wide frequency range, and more particularly, to a piezoelectric beam extending in a horizontal direction; a fixing member for fixing both ends of the piezoelectric beam; and a moving mass connected to the piezoelectric beam to allow the piezoelectric beam to pass through, and to be able to move autonomously along the piezoelectric beam through a through hole having a spare space other than the space through which the piezoelectric beam passes. The displacement of the piezoelectric beam increases as it moves to the possible position of the piezoelectric beam, and as the displacement becomes larger than the free space, the moving mass is fixed at the position of the resonable piezoelectric beam. It relates to a self-resonance-controlled piezoelectric energy harvester.
